Naming and identity

The name “I’m Walkin’ Here” is a wink at one of the most quoted movie lines set in NYC, reframed contextually for walking tours. The logo is a nod to the city's most underrated local celebrity: the humble pigeon, illustrated with all the personality and energy of the tours themselves. And the palette had to include yellow. Eye-catching, unique, and quintessentially NY.

out-of-home presence

A tour brand lives on the street, not just on a screen. I designed a physical identity to take advantage of that: business cards, review cards, branded stickers, hand sanitizer (a guest favorite and a walking billboard), and a branded flag that doubles as way-finding for groups and a piece of street-level advertising.
